diff options
author | Thedro Neely <thedroneely@gmail.com> | 2020-01-23 01:39:58 -0500 |
---|---|---|
committer | Thedro Neely <thedroneely@gmail.com> | 2020-01-23 01:41:11 -0500 |
commit | ace114e82833b55e204a3fdf8eca528cc9712d4d (patch) | |
tree | c739a1a9b3991226d925122dc588550ba2cd299d /templates/base/head_navbar.tmpl | |
download | gitea-templates-ace114e82833b55e204a3fdf8eca528cc9712d4d.tar.gz gitea-templates-ace114e82833b55e204a3fdf8eca528cc9712d4d.tar.bz2 gitea-templates-ace114e82833b55e204a3fdf8eca528cc9712d4d.zip |
templates: Base commit
Diffstat (limited to 'templates/base/head_navbar.tmpl')
-rw-r--r-- | templates/base/head_navbar.tmpl | 136 |
1 files changed, 136 insertions, 0 deletions
diff --git a/templates/base/head_navbar.tmpl b/templates/base/head_navbar.tmpl new file mode 100644 index 0000000..8ed5a94 --- /dev/null +++ b/templates/base/head_navbar.tmpl @@ -0,0 +1,136 @@ +<div class="ui container" id="navbar"> + <div class="item brand" style="justify-content: space-between;"> + <a title="Head back to https://www.thedroneely.com" href="/"> + <img style="display: inline; border-radius: 6px;" class="ui mini image" src="/android-chrome-192x192.png"> + <span style="margin-left: 0.65em;">www.thedroneely.com</span> + </a> + <div class="ui basic icon button mobile-only" id="navbar-expand-toggle"> + <i class="sidebar icon"></i> + </div> + </div> + + {{if .IsSigned}} + <a class="item {{if .PageIsDashboard}}active{{end}}" href="{{AppSubUrl}}/">{{.i18n.Tr "dashboard"}}</a> + <a class="item {{if .PageIsIssues}}active{{end}}" href="{{AppSubUrl}}/issues">{{.i18n.Tr "issues"}}</a> + <a class="item {{if .PageIsPulls}}active{{end}}" href="{{AppSubUrl}}/pulls">{{.i18n.Tr "pull_requests"}}</a> + {{if .ShowMilestonesDashboardPage}}<a class="item {{if .PageIsMilestonesDashboard}}active{{end}}" href="{{AppSubUrl}}/milestones">{{.i18n.Tr "milestones"}}</a>{{end}} + <a class="item {{if .PageIsExplore}}active{{end}}" href="{{AppSubUrl}}/explore/repos">{{.i18n.Tr "explore"}}</a> + {{else if .IsLandingPageHome}} + <a class="item {{if .PageIsHome}}active{{end}}" href="{{AppSubUrl}}/">{{.i18n.Tr "home"}}</a> + <a class="item {{if .PageIsExplore}}active{{end}}" href="{{AppSubUrl}}/explore/repos">{{.i18n.Tr "explore"}}</a> + {{else if .IsLandingPageExplore}} + <a class="item {{if .PageIsExplore}}active{{end}}" href="{{AppSubUrl}}/explore/repos">{{.i18n.Tr "home"}}</a> + {{else if .IsLandingPageOrganizations}} + <a class="item {{if .PageIsExplore}}active{{end}}" href="{{AppSubUrl}}/explore/organizations">{{.i18n.Tr "home"}}</a> + {{end}} + + {{template "custom/extra_links" .}} + + {{/* + <div class="item"> + <div class="ui icon input"> + <input class="searchbox" type="text" placeholder="{{.i18n.Tr "search_project"}}"> + <i class="search icon"></i> + </div> + </div> + */}} + + {{if .IsSigned}} + <div class="right stackable menu"> + <a href="{{AppSubUrl}}/notifications" class="item poping up" data-content='{{.i18n.Tr "notifications"}}' data-variation="tiny inverted"> + <span class="text"> + <i class="fitted octicon octicon-bell"></i> + <span class="sr-mobile-only">{{.i18n.Tr "notifications"}}</span> + + {{if .NotificationUnreadCount}} + <span class="ui red label"> + {{.NotificationUnreadCount}} + </span> + {{end}} + </span> + </a> + + <div class="ui dropdown jump item poping up" data-content="{{.i18n.Tr "create_new"}}" data-variation="tiny inverted"> + <span class="text"> + <i class="fitted octicon octicon-plus"></i> + <span class="sr-mobile-only">{{.i18n.Tr "create_new"}}</span> + <i class="fitted octicon octicon-triangle-down not-mobile"></i> + </span> + <div class="menu"> + <a class="item" href="{{AppSubUrl}}/repo/create"> + <i class="octicon octicon-plus"></i> {{.i18n.Tr "new_repo"}} + </a> + <a class="item" href="{{AppSubUrl}}/repo/migrate"> + <i class="octicon octicon-repo-clone"></i> {{.i18n.Tr "new_migrate"}} + </a> + {{if .SignedUser.CanCreateOrganization}} + <a class="item" href="{{AppSubUrl}}/org/create"> + <i class="octicon octicon-organization"></i> {{.i18n.Tr "new_org"}} + </a> + {{end}} + </div><!-- end content create new menu --> + </div><!-- end dropdown menu create new --> + + <div class="ui dropdown jump item poping up" tabindex="-1" data-content="{{.i18n.Tr "user_profile_and_more"}}" data-variation="tiny inverted"> + <span class="text"> + <img class="ui tiny avatar image" src="{{.SignedUser.RelAvatarLink}}"> + <span class="sr-only">{{.i18n.Tr "user_profile_and_more"}}</span> + <span class="mobile-only">{{.SignedUser.Name}}</span> + <i class="fitted octicon octicon-triangle-down not-mobile" tabindex="-1"></i> + </span> + <div class="menu user-menu" tabindex="-1"> + <div class="ui header"> + {{.i18n.Tr "signed_in_as"}} <strong>{{.SignedUser.Name}}</strong> + </div> + + <div class="divider"></div> + <a class="item" href="{{AppSubUrl}}/{{.SignedUser.Name}}"> + <i class="octicon octicon-person"></i> + {{.i18n.Tr "your_profile"}}<!-- Your profile --> + </a> + <a class="item" href="{{AppSubUrl}}/{{.SignedUser.Name}}?tab=stars"> + <i class="octicon octicon-star"></i> + {{.i18n.Tr "your_starred"}} + </a> + <a class="{{if .PageIsUserSettings}}active{{end}} item" href="{{AppSubUrl}}/user/settings"> + <i class="octicon octicon-settings"></i> + {{.i18n.Tr "your_settings"}}<!-- Your settings --> + </a> + <a class="item" target="_blank" rel="noopener noreferrer" href="https://docs.gitea.io"> + <i class="octicon octicon-question"></i> + {{.i18n.Tr "help"}}<!-- Help --> + </a> + {{if .IsAdmin}} + <div class="divider"></div> + + <a class="{{if .PageIsAdmin}}active{{end}} item" href="{{AppSubUrl}}/admin"> + <i class="icon settings"></i> + {{.i18n.Tr "admin_panel"}}<!-- Admin Panel --> + </a> + {{end}} + + <div class="divider"></div> + <a class="item" href="{{AppSubUrl}}/user/logout"> + <i class="octicon octicon-sign-out"></i> + {{.i18n.Tr "sign_out"}}<!-- Sign Out --> + </a> + </div><!-- end content avatar menu --> + </div><!-- end dropdown avatar menu --> + </div><!-- end signed user right menu --> + + {{else}} + + <!-- <a class="item" target="_blank" rel="noopener noreferrer" href="https://docs.gitea.io">{{.i18n.Tr "help"}}</a> --> + <div class="right stackable menu"> + {{if .ShowRegistrationButton}} + <a class="item{{if .PageIsSignUp}} active{{end}}" href="{{AppSubUrl}}/user/sign_up"> + <i class="octicon octicon-person"></i> {{.i18n.Tr "register"}} + </a> + {{end}} + <a class="item{{if .PageIsSignIn}} active{{end}}" rel="nofollow" href="{{AppSubUrl}}/user/login?redirect_to={{.Link}}"> + <i class="octicon octicon-sign-in"></i> {{.i18n.Tr "sign_in"}} + </a> + </div><!-- end anonymous right menu --> + + {{end}} +</div> |